Defining Microsoft Teams Governance

Microsoft Teams governance refers to the policies, roles, responsibilities, and processes that guide how Microsoft Teams is managed and used within an organization. As businesses increasingly rely on Microsoft Teams for collaboration, it becomes essential to ensure that the platform is used effectively and securely.

Effective governance involves setting clear guidelines on how teams are created, how data is managed, and how users interact within the platform. These guidelines help mitigate risks related to data security and regulatory compliance. By establishing a comprehensive governance strategy, we can help organizations maintain consistency and control over their Microsoft Teams environment.

Key Benefits of Implementing Governance Strategies

There are several key benefits associated with implementing robust Microsoft Teams governance strategies. First, governance enhances data security by defining who has access to what information, reducing the risk of unauthorized data breaches. Second, it ensures compliance with industry standards and regulations, which is critical for organizations that handle sensitive data.
Another significant benefit is improved user experience. When governance policies are in place, users have a clear understanding of how they should interact with the platform. This clarity reduces confusion and enhances productivity. Additionally, governance helps in resource management by preventing the uncontrolled growth of teams and sprawl of data.

Best Practices for Maintaining Governance in Microsoft Teams

Maintaining effective Microsoft Teams governance requires a well-thought-out strategy and ongoing management. One of the best practices is to establish clear policies and procedures. These should outline the lifecycle management of teams, from creation to archiving or deletion.

Moreover, regularly auditing and monitoring activity within Microsoft Teams is crucial. This helps to identify any compliance issues or areas where governance policies may need adjustments. Ensuring that all stakeholders are trained and aware of governance policies is also essential for achieving long-term success.

Furthermore, leveraging automation can significantly enhance the efficiency of governance tasks. Tools that automate team creation, policy enforcement, and monitoring can save time and reduce the burden on IT teams. Finally, fostering a culture of accountability and continuous improvement will help sustain effective governance practices over time.

What is Microsoft Teams governance?
Microsoft Teams governance refers to the policies, procedures, and controls implemented to manage and regulate the use of Microsoft Teams within an organization. It’s about ensuring that the platform is used effectively, securely, and in compliance with both internal standards and external regulations.
Governance is crucial because it helps organizations maintain control over data security, user access, information architecture, and compliance issues. Moreover, by enforcing governance, businesses can optimize the teamwork and collaboration experience whilst minimizing risks associated with data breaches and policy non-compliance.
Some best practices include establishing clear policies regarding team creation and naming conventions, implementing data retention policies, managing guest access wisely, regularly reviewing and updating governance policies, and providing ongoing training and support to all users.
